Blazers Can’t Let One Jerami Grant Performance Cloud a Clear-Cut Decision

In the wake of Jerami Grant’s electric performance that momentarily energized the Portland Trail Blazers, a pressing question looms over Rip City: should one standout game reshape the team’s long-standing strategic direction? As Grant’s recent display rekindled hope among fans and analysts alike, the Blazers face the critical challenge of separating short-term sparks from sustainable progress. This article examines why Portland cannot afford to let a single game influence what remains a painfully obvious and necessary decision for the franchise’s future.

Blazers Face Reality Despite Jerami Grant’s Impressive Performance

Jerami Grant’s performance was undoubtedly a highlight for the Blazers, showcasing his ability to take over a game and provide much-needed scoring and defensive versatility. However, despite his standout numbers, the broader issues plaguing the team remain glaringly clear. Talent alone can’t mask the lack of consistent production from key players, nor can it resolve the dysfunction that roots deeper than any single game. The Blazers must recognize that relying on sporadic performances, no matter how impressive, won’t change their trajectory without a clear strategic overhaul.

To put it into perspective, here are some critical factors the Blazers need to address immediately:

  • Roster balance: Over-reliance on isolated stars leads to predictability and stagnation.
  • Defensive lapses: Even with Grant’s defensive effort, team-wide breakdowns continue to put them behind.
  • Depth concerns: The bench lacks consistent impact players to relieve pressure on starters.

Grant’s outing is a bright spot, but the Blazers must confront the reality that no single player’s effort will instantly fix systemic problems. For sustained success, an honest evaluation of the roster and commitment to meaningful changes are non-negotiable. Rip City deserves a team willing to face these challenges, not just celebrate fleeting flashes of brilliance.

Evaluating Long Term Team Strategy Beyond Individual Game Highlights

In the high-stakes environment of the NBA, it’s critical for the Portland Trail Blazers to prioritize sustainable growth over momentary flashes of brilliance. While Jerami Grant’s recent performance showcased his undeniable talent and potential impact, it would be a disservice to the franchise’s long-term trajectory to let a single game redefine their core strategy. Building a championship contender requires a balanced approach, emphasizing consistent contributions, foundational player development, and strategic roster moves rather than reactions based on isolated highlight reels.

The front office must remain committed to a clear vision that transcends individual performances. This involves a diligent evaluation of the roster that goes beyond point totals and highlight dunks, focusing on:

  • Fit within the team’s identity and system.
  • Consistency and impact over an entire season.
  • Potential for growth and leadership.

Prioritizing Sustainable Growth over Short Term Momentum in Rip City

The Blazers’ front office and coaching staff face a critical juncture that extends far beyond the flashes of brilliance from a single standout performance. Jerami Grant’s recent game might have ignited hope among fans, but it should not obscure the broader trajectory that Rip City must pursue. Relying on one night of momentum risks distracting from the systemic rebuild necessary to build a consistently competitive team. The organization’s focus needs to remain firmly fixed on long-term player development, cap flexibility, and a strategic asset accumulation rather than short-lived streaks.

To illustrate key priorities, the team should emphasize the following pillars:

  • Development of young talent: Investing minutes and training in promising draft picks and emerging players.
  • Cap management: Maintaining flexibility to attract free agents while avoiding overcommitment.
  • Strategic trades: Leveraging assets to solidify core strengths rather than react impulsively to recent performances.
